Understanding the German Drogerie
To genuinely appreciate the German pharmacy, one need to first understand the distinction between a Drogerie and an Apotheke (pharmacy).
The Apotheke (Pharmacy): This is where prescription medications, strong over-the-counter drugs, and specialized medical suggestions are dispensed. They are strictly regulated and typically staffed by pharmacists in white coats.The Drogerie (Drugstore): This is where one opts for health, charm, individual care, child products, cleaning products, and healthy foods. Prescription drugs are not sold here.

Founded in 1973, dm is a cultural touchstone in Germany. Germans consistently vote dm as their preferred seller. The stores are diligently organized, wheelchair- and [Präparate Zur Gewichtsabnahme Deutschland](https://onlyprofityou.com/profile/edrugstore-germany4529/) stroller-friendly, and lit with warm, inviting lighting. dm is particularly well-known for pioneering the "personal label" transformation in Germany, offering premium-quality cosmetics and skincare at a fraction of the cost of name brands.
2. Dirk Rossmann GmbH (Rossmann)
As the second-largest chain, Rossmann is common throughout German towns and cities. Rossmann is understood for aggressive discounting, weekly coupon books, and a wonderful digital app. While its store design can sometimes feel somewhat more utilitarian than dm, its item range is similarly excellent.
3. Müller
Müller differ due to the fact that it operates practically like a mini-department store. While it has the same substantial drugstore and organic food areas as dm and Rossmann, a common Müller will likewise include a huge toy department, a stationery and book section, and a high-end luxury perfume counter.

Among the best secrets of the German pharmacy is the quality of its private-label brands. In many nations, store-brand products are considered as inexpensive, inferior options to name brand names. In Germany, the reverse is typically true.

German consumer magazines (like Stiftung Warentest) routinely test pharmacy home brands versus high-end brand names, and Eigenmarken regularly win leading honors for quality, component safety, and value.
Popular House Brands to Look For:Balea (dm): The indisputable king of budget body care. From shower gels that change fragrances seasonally to abundant body milks and facial serums, Balea is a cult favorite.Alverde (dm): A licensed natural cosmetics (Naturkosmetik) brand name that is extremely budget-friendly.
